What Is a Document Checklist?
A document checklist is a comprehensive checklist that is used as a tool to guide or help an individual stay on top of their tasks. A typical checklist enumerates the various requirements used in a number of areas including business, immigration and project management.
According to an online article by Business.com, document challenges make up 21.3% of productivity loss. Further, professionals spend about 50% of their time searching for and looking up information. It also takes an average of 18 minutes to locate a document.

How to Create a Document Checklist
To create a comprehensive document checklist, you need to have a general understanding of the kinds of documents you will need. Step 1: Do Research
As discussed in the previous section, you need to do some adequate research first before enumerating items on your checklist. A document checklist is not a spontaneous or random list, it requires deliberate planning. Part of planning or preparation is research and evaluation. You need to inform yourself and evaluate the information presented to you. By doing this, you are able to craft a more comprehensive and accurate document checklist. Lastly, it is important to note that prior research may be done by someone other than yourself. A lot of firms and organizations prepare document checklists for their clients and customers’ convenience.
Step 2: Establish the Format
The next step in crafting a document checklist is ensuring a format that works. There is more than one way of creating a checklist. You can always use a standard checklist template with simple lines and checkboxes. But others prefer to get a little more creative. Further, how detailed and specific you want your checklist to be also entirely depends on you. It is not necessary to place additional notes under each item on your checklist; but if you feel that the notes may be helpful reminders then you can do so. Just keep in mind that the format of your document checklist should guide or help the reader to easily understand the content.
Step 3: List the Documents
The meat of your document checklist will obviously be the items listed down. Depending on your objective, the items in your checklist will be the documents required to accomplish or complete your objective. If your objective is to obtain a tourist visa, then your checklist should list all the different documents needed for submission. As suggested in the previous section, it would be a good idea to arrange your checklist in a logical manner as well. A checklist that has structure and logical flow can potentially be more helpful than a random or disorganized list. You can arrange your document checklist in any manner you see fit. For example, your list can be arranged according to prioritization or urgency.
Step 4: Keep the List Updated
Once you have completed your checklist, the last step is to constantly update it. A document checklist is rarely stagnant, it is an on-going process that needs to be constantly updated. When you prepare a checklist, you go through the list item by item. It is only in some cases that several items can be crossed off at the same time. Otherwise, when you have accomplished or completed a document, you can move on to the next one. Basically, you need to make sure that your document checklist is updated to prevent any unnecessary confusion.
